Output 751a656cbde8da5dc2f5f3c8be9872003259a35831f44ad5eadbbc10d6956019:1

value
3420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b78397287dcc6440ad6a81abdcfd9637567391a OP_EQUAL
address
3Cws4UccEVcDpx1vB678pfQkWf8Ff3F8DS
transaction
751a656cbde8da5dc2f5f3c8be9872003259a35831f44ad5eadbbc10d6956019
confirmations
576689
spent
true